Crock Pot Cheesy Chicken Spaghetti Recipe

Do you want a recipe that kids and adults alike will love? This easy recipe of Crock Pot Cheesy Chicken Spaghetti is the answer to your prayers! Yum!

Crock Pot Cheesy Chicken Spaghetti

Do you want a recipe that kids and adults alike will love? This easy recipe of Crock Pot Cheesy Chicken Spaghetti is the answer to your prayers! Yum!
4.87 from 22 votes
Print Pin
Course: Main
Cuisine: Comfort Food
Keyword: Crock Pot Cheesy Chicken Spaghetti
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 4 hours
Total Time: 4 hours 10 minutes
Servings: 8 people
Calories: 526kcal
Author: Aunt Lou
Prevent your screen from going dark

Ingredients

  • 16 oz box spaghetti cooked al dente
  • 2 cups chicken broth
  • 10.5 oz can cream of mushroom soup
  • 10.5 oz can cream of chicken soup
  • 4 green onions chopped
  • 16 oz pkg pasteurized process cheese spread cubed
  • 4 boneless skinless, chicken breasts , cubed
  • 1/4 teaspoon celery sal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• garnish: fresh grated parmesan

Instructions

  • Mix together all your ingredients in your 6-quart crock pot (I used good ol' Sir Hamilton, my Hamilton Beach Programmable Insulated Slow Cooker)
  • Cover and cook low for 3-4 hours, stirring frequently
  • Serve with fresh grated parmesan, if desired

Video

Notes

  • This recipe is from Gooseberry Patch's Everyday Slow Cooker.
  • I used thin spaghetti because that is what we like in this house, but you can use regular if that is what you and yours prefer.
  • If you want it cheesier, you can always add in some more cheese. Make it your own!
  • We love using this this 6 quart slow cooker,but any 6 quart slow cooker will work.
  • Check out all our favorite recommendations for cookbooks, slow cookers and low carb essentials in our Amazon Influencer Shop.
  • As with any of our recipes, carb counts, calorie counts and nutritional information varies greatly. As a result, your nutritional content depends on which products you choose to use when cooking this dish. The auto-calculation is just an automated estimate and should NOT be used for specific dietary needs.
  • All slow cookers cook differently, so cooking times are always a basic guideline and should always be tested first in your own slow cooker and time adjusted as needed.

Nutrition

Calories: 526kcal | Carbohydrates: 54g | Protein: 45g | Fat: 13g | Saturated Fat: 6g | Cholesterol: 101mg | Sodium: 1847mg | Potassium: 869mg | Fiber: 2g | Sugar: 7g | Vitamin A: 718IU | Vitamin C: 7mg | Calcium: 358mg | Iron: 2mg

  7. Gail Plaskiewicz says

    September 12, 2017 at 1:28 pm

    5 stars
    This sounds really good but I have a question. It says stirring frequently. I thought you weren’t supposed to open the lid on your crock pot to stir because the temperature drops and then it takes longer to cook? I want to try it though. It sounds yummy!

    • Aunt Lou says

      September 18, 2017 at 2:28 pm

      5 stars
      Hi Gail!

      The reason for stirring is because of the cheese. If it gets stuck on the edges, it would crust up. Hope that helps. Enjoy!

      Aunt Lou

  8. Regina says

    September 12, 2017 at 12:36 pm

    Hi! This looks delicious! Did your noodles not get all “mooshy” being cooked that long? Or should they be added in the last part of cooking?

    • Aunt Lou says

      September 18, 2017 at 2:27 pm

      5 stars
      Hi Regina!

      They actually didn’t! I didn’t over cook them beforehand though. Just a little past al dente. Enjoy!

      Aunt Lou
